    Description

    The United States Government Publishing Office is seeking a Combined Synopsis/Solicitation for the production of mailing packages consisting of personalized English and Bilingual (Spanish/English) personalized notices, booklet inserts, form inserts, Business Reply Mail (BRM) Refund envelopes, Courtesy Reply Mail (CRM) Refund envelopes, and mail-out envelopes. These packages require various operations such as data processing, composition, printing, binding, gathering, presorting, and distribution. The purpose of these packages is to provide important information to recipients in an organized and personalized manner.
